Output 8e8c17afbbe441bdd6f73e61c59cdd6afa952c73a88ec2154675e072ce9416b9:0

value
53843673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ede9101bcc9baccd8a961a46ff1bb882458a841 OP_EQUAL
address
MDdakWZfjnP7KRJDEcg52ZRyC3faWReA4g
transaction
8e8c17afbbe441bdd6f73e61c59cdd6afa952c73a88ec2154675e072ce9416b9
spent
true